Re: Tuff Fish\'s proposal cleared by CA Sec. of State for petition circ
there are no reasonable reasons for restricting multitabling. a few obvious reasons:
-on the business side of things: it severely cuts the amount of games and hence revenue for the operators. operators have no legitimate business reason (unless they hate money) to shortchange revenue this way. -a shark will very likely have a higher winrate single tabling, so the idea that one can protect fish by giving the fish even less of a chance to survive a shark encounter is... dumb? -there are more fish than there are sharks. fish/shark ratio guarantees there will always be fish. restricting mutitabling because one believes it lengthens the lifespan of fish as a group and as a result ensures profitable games is a flawed and proven incorrect model. see: partypoker (pre-frist) and now pokerstars. -fish like to multitable, too. -and so forth my belief is that informed people don't support stupid proposals by ignorant people, hence why i stick to my 'nay' vote. |
